Calandre wrote:Group A: Atletico Madrid, Juventus, Olympiacos and Malmoe
Group B: Real Madrid, Basel, Liverpool and Ludogorets
Group C: Benfica, Zenit, Bayer Leverkusen and Monaco
Group D: Arsenal, Borussia Dortmund, Galatasaray and Anderlecht
Group E: Bayern Munich, Manchester City, CSKA Moscow and Roma
Group F: Barcelona, PSG, Ajax and APOEL
Group G: Chelsea, Schalke, Sporting Lisbon and Maribor
Group H: Porto, Shakhtar Donetsk, Athletic Bilbao and B. Borisov

Francesco wrote:According to The Times, Chelsea will offer Fernando Torres to Roma in exchange for Tottenham target Mattia Destro.
It had already been reported in Italian media that Roma directors Walter Sabatini and Mauro Baldissoni had travelled to London, as they were pictured getting on to the flight in Rome.
Thursday’s edition of The Times claims this trip was for talks with Chelsea over Destro, who has been heavily linked with Spurs.
They could even include Spanish striker Torres as part of the move, ending his often troubled time at Stamford Bridge.
Torres, who cost £50m from Liverpool in 2011, would join Roma on loan to help lower Destro’s £20m price-tag.
However, the Giallorossi would require Chelsea to pay some of Torres’ wages, which are currently £180,000 per week.
